Central Bucks East pushed the top seed to the brink, but second-chance points proved costly in a 56-45 loss to Upper Dublin High School in the Suburban One League Tournament title game Tuesday night. 

According to The Reporter, the Patriots trimmed the deficit to four early in the fourth quarter, only to see Upper Dublin grab five offensive rebounds on one trip before finally converting. That sequence swung the momentum back to the Cardinals and underscored the biggest difference of the night, as East struggled to finish defensive possessions down the stretch, according to the report.

Still, there were bright spots for Central Bucks East High School. Junior Haley Moran poured in 19 points, including a late three that made it a one-possession game, while freshman Payton Williams added 14 in a poised postseason performance, according to gameplay reporting. 

Senior Jess Lockwood also reached a milestone, scoring her 1,000th career point in the first half. East showed it can trade punches with one of District 1’s top teams, a promising sign as the Patriots head into the district playoffs with a first-round bye.
